PARM Error and Shape Builder Tool causing Illustrator Crash

  • November 7, 2019
  • 1 reply
  • 1139 views

Hello community.

I've run into an issue with using the Shape Builder tool and Illustrator crashing. 

Here's how it started:

1. I opened a PDF document in Illustrator. (The file's original language is in Chinese, I don't know if this helps).

2. My process is using the Shape Builder Tool to quickly fill in groups of stroked shapes. 

3. The first couple of instances, when clicking the "highlighted" areas to fill with a color, the shape would glitch out in a way that didn't appear to be related to the original shape. (Screenshot included)

4. After a couple more tries, I would get a PARM error message after trying the same procedure. 

5. After another try or two, Illustrator would immediately close. Not even slow down and crash, just close. 

 

I have gone through a couple of cycles of reopening the file, restarting Illustrator, and trying the same procedure in new documents. This hasn't been an issue until now and it appears to be on and off. Is there something I could be doing to prevent or fix this?

 

OS: Mac Mojave Ver. 10.14.6 / 2.3 GHz i5 8 gigs RAM

Illustrator Ver. 23.0.05
